Pixar’s ‘Elemental’ Experience Kicks Off Multi-City Mall Tour in NYC

Disney and Pixar’s Elemental Experience — an immersive, thematic environment that invites fans into the imaginative world of Elemental —kicked off this morning in New York City’s Brookfield Place. The film’s director, Peter Sohn, dropped in for the ribbon-cutting to officially launch the first tour stop that runs through May 21.

The multi-city mall tour features film-themed activities for visitors of all ages, including photo and video opportunities, a chance to draw with Pixar artists, a movie-ticket grab in a wind tunnel, plus giveaways and special film content.

Sponsored by Fandango, Dolby and I’m the Chef Too, Disney and Pixar’s Elemental Experience will roll on to Chicago’s Yorktown Center (May 26-28), Dallas’ Stonebriar Centre (June 2-4), Los Angeles’ The Americana at Brand (June 10-12) and San Francisco’s Hillsdale Shopping Center (June 16-18).

Elemental is an original feature film set in Element City, where Fire-, Water-, Earth- and Air-residents live together. The story introduces Ember, a tough, quick-witted and fiery young woman (voiced by Leah Lewis) whose friendship with a fun, sappy, go-with-the-flow guy named Wade (Mamoudou Athie) challenges her beliefs about the world they live in.

Directed by Peter Sohn, produced by Denise Ream, p.g.a., and executive produced by Pete Docter, “Elemental” features a screenplay by John Hoberg & Kat Likkel and Brenda Hsueh with story by Sohn, Hoberg & Likkel and Hsueh. The film’s original score was composed and conducted by Thomas Newman.
